This is a proposal for a user-visible GCC compiler option for aggressive
inlining that is currently only available at -O3 as internal inline parameters
(--param=early-inlining-insns=14 --param=inline-heuristics-hint-percent=600
--param=inline-min-speedup=15 --param=max-inline-insns-auto=30
--param=max-inline-insns-single=200).
I got some perf data for Envoy (https://github.com/envoyproxy/envoy) and SPEC
CPU2017 intrate benchmarks on C7g.2xlarge w Ubuntu22 + gcc-11.4.0. We see perf
gains (2% - 5%) using these aggressive inline parameters (at -O2). Attached is
a patch for this change.
We do not want to add these inline limits at ‘-O2’ itself, as we see from one
of the SPEC CPU tests that got slower. Also, more inline tuning at -O2 would
make some of the symbols not to be available for probe/ debug (that are
available when not using these aggressive inline params).
